How To Choose The Right Gift Hampers For This Upcoming Holiday Season?

The holidays are typically supposed to be happy times, but it can be daunting when you have to pick gifts for your loved ones. Nothing can be more overwhelming than trying to find the right gift for a special someone. However, there’s no need to worry, as gift hampers are now back.

Thankfully, those cringe-worthy old gift baskets are no more. They used to be synonymous with stale crackers, old chocolate, and almost rancid fruit. With the retail market for gifts valued at a staggering $62 billion in 2019 globally, there is no shortage of gifting ideas this holiday season. 

Gift hampers are one such excellent gift idea. They are similar to the gift basket, minus the generic and thoughtless gifts. Instead, gift hampers can be personalized to suit each recipient and make their day. 

Here’s how you can choose the right gift hamper and ensure that your gift is the best among all. 

Begin Early

The biggest mistake you can make is starting your shopping at the last minute. Gifts are best when they are well planned. Therefore, it would not be too early if you began thinking about gifts as early as October. It will give you enough time to make changes. 

Think About The Receiver

Sometimes, you tend to overthink and forget about the person receiving the gift. So, the first thing to do is list the names of people you will be gifting. This allows you to plan for gift hampers that suit each receiver’s interests. 

Think About Demographics

The next task is to consider basic details such as gender, sex, age, location, etc., on the above list. This helps you organize your shopping based on categories. While it may seem stereotypical, gender-based gifts are still practical most of the time.  

For example, the self-grooming department carries shaving kits and waxing strips. You do not want to be gifting waxing strips to the men on your list. Nor do you want to gift a shaving kit to a female colleague or classmate.  

Think About Habits And Rituals

Knowing about someone’s habits helps you look for more appropriate gifts. For example, you know which department to visit if you have an aunt who tends to her garden every day. Therefore, adding habits, rituals, hobbies, etc., to the list helps decide appropriate gifts. 

Think About Trends And Fads

In the present day, age is no bar for trends and fads. Therefore, it is best to be abreast of the latest trends and fads. For example, in the home décor department, the minimalist theme is out, and the maximalist theme is in for 2021. 

Think About Your Relationship with the Recipient

You can modify your gift hamper based on how close you are to the receiver. Obviously, you will not want to spend the same amount on a gift for a work colleague as you would for your sibling or close friend. 

Additionally, you can choose more personal gifts like chocolates, candies, clothing, etc., for close acquaintances, but you must stick to generic items like wine, wallet, belts, etc., when gifting your boss or manager. 

Gifting during the holiday season can be fun if you plan it right. Keep the aforementioned points in mind while you look for gift hampers for the upcoming holiday season. Remember, most of the time, it’s the thought that counts more than the cost.
